A 1936 Texas Centennial Marker on the approach to Farmers Branch City Hall at 13000 William Dodson Pkwy notes this as the first site of the office of the Texian Land and Emigration Company, best known in these parts as "The Peters Colony".

Some sources refer to the company as the "Texas Land and Emigration Company". The marker is brief and to the point:
Site of the first agency, January, 1845, of the Texian Land and Emigration Company. Generally known as "Peters' Colony" in honor of William S. Peters who, under a colonization contract secured in 1841 from the Republic of Texas, introduced more than ten thousand settlers to 17 counties of North Texas.

Turn to your left and you'll see Keenan Cemetery, named for the pioneers who arrived here before The Peters Colony was officially established. The Keenans and many of the families of area settlers can be found there, and their son, John, was the first child born in the area, and unfortunately, the first to pass on, as an infant.
